The Growing Importance of Accurate Pool Water Testing

Australia has one of the highest rates of pool ownership globally. According to industry estimates, more than 3 million swimming pools are installed across the country, increasing the need for effective water quality management.

Pool chemistry can change rapidly due to:

  • High UV exposure
  • Heavy rainfall
  • Increased swimmer activity
  • Organic contamination
  • Chemical overdosing
  • Temperature fluctuations

Without proper testing, even small chemical imbalances can create major operational problems.

For example:

  • Low alkalinity can cause unstable pH levels
  • High acidity may accelerate the corrosion of metal fixtures
  • Elevated aluminium levels may indicate coagulation or contamination issues
  • Poor chemical balance can reduce chlorine efficiency by up to 80%

Why Alkalinity Is Critical for Pool Stability

Total alkalinity acts as a buffer that stabilises pH fluctuations. In Australian conditions, where heat and evaporation can quickly alter water chemistry, maintaining balanced alkalinity is particularly important.

Low alkalinity often leads to:

  • Rapid pH swings
  • Corrosive water
  • Increased chemical consumption
  • Surface etching

Excessively high alkalinity may result in:

  • Cloudy water
  • Scale formation
  • Reduced chlorine effectiveness

Industry best practices generally recommend maintaining total alkalinity between 80 and 120 ppm for most swimming pools.

Aluminium Monitoring: An Often Overlooked Pool Water Parameter

Many pool operators focus only on chlorine and pH, overlooking trace contaminants such as aluminium.

Aluminium may enter pool systems through:

  • Coagulants used in water treatment
  • Source water contamination
  • Chemical residues

Excess aluminium can contribute to:

  • Water cloudiness
  • Filter inefficiency
  • Sediment accumulation
  • Potential staining issues

In commercial pools and aquatic facilities, monitoring aluminium can support better filtration performance and improved water clarity.
